clear
ueConfig=struct('NCellID',0,'NULRB',25,'NSubframe',4,'RNTI',82,'CyclicPrefixUL','Normal','NTxAnts',1);
puschConfig=struct('NLayers',1,'OrthCover','Off','PRBSet',0,'Modulation','QPSK','RV',0,'Shortened',0);
addpath('../../debug/lte/phy/lib/phch/test')
NULRB=[6 15 25 50 100];
Peak=[];
k=1;
for r=1:length(NULRB)
fprintf('NULRB: %d\n',NULRB(r));
for l=1:NULRB(r)
trblkin=randi(2,l*5,1)-1;
ueConfig.NULRB=NULRB(r);
puschConfig.PRBSet=(0:(l-1))';
[cw, info]=lteULSCH(ueConfig,puschConfig,trblkin);
cw_mat=ltePUSCH(ueConfig,puschConfig,cw);
idx=ltePUSCHIndices(ueConfig,puschConfig);
subframe_mat = lteULResourceGrid(ueConfig);
subframe_mat(idx)=cw_mat;
waveform = lteSCFDMAModulate(ueConfig,subframe_mat,0);
waveform = waveform*sqrt(512)/sqrt(l)*NULRB(r)/10;
Peak(k)=max(max(abs(real(waveform))),max(abs(imag(waveform))));
k=k+1;
end
end
plot(Peak(:)')
